No direct sources confirm the exact guitar, pickups, or amp used on the studio recording of 'A Modern Way of Letting Go' riff section. No pedalboard or studio notes found. All gear is estimated based on genre, era, and typical UK indie/alt-rock setups of early 2000s. Studio recording, year: 2002.

Difficulty

The riff requires fast, aggressive alternate picking and tight rhythm control, with precise palm muting to maintain clarity and punch at high speed.
